Customer Success Manager

6 hours ago


Macquarie Park New South Wales, Australia GreenSketch Full time $60,000 - $120,000 per year

As a Customer Success Manager, you will be responsible for ensuring that our installer customers in Australia fully utilise
GreenSketch
- a sophisticated platform that seamlessly combines design, quoting, procurement, CRM and energy certificate creation, featuring integrated high-resolution maps.

Key Duties

CRM

  • Establish and maintain strong relationships with installer customers in Australia & be their main point of contact.
  • Communicate with customers regularly to understand their business progress, needs, and challenges, and provide timely support and solutions.
  • Coordinate internal resources to ensure customer issues are resolved promptly and customer satisfaction is improved.

Promotion & Training

  • Introduce our solar software to new customers
  • Provide software usage training for customers (including online and on-site training)
  • Create training materials and documents
  • Produce engaging content that promotes the software's features and benefits

Analysis and Feedback

  • Understand the business needs and pain points of customers and provide personalised solutions.
  • Collect customer feedback and convey it to the product team to drive continuous software improvement
  • Participate in product testing & verification

Success Indicator Management

  • Set and track customer success metrics such as activity, retention rate, satisfaction, etc., and report to management regularly.
  • Develop and implement customer success plan
  • Identify potential customer risks and take proactive measures to prevent and resolve them

Market Insight and Competitive Analysis

  • Understand the dynamics of the Australian photovoltaic market and the competitive landscape
  • Collect customer feedback on market trends and competitors to support product and service optimisation.

About You

  • Minimum 2 years of experience in CSM, customer service, or sales support (experience in the software industry preferred).
  • Familiarity with the photovoltaic industry or related field knowledge (advantageous)
  • Excellent interpersonal, problem-solving and decision-making skills
  • A technical background with proficiency in using office software and CRM tools.
  • Fluent in English in all areas of communication to communicate effectively with Australian customers.
  • Team-oriented with the ability to collaborate with cross-functional teams to complete tasks.
  • Self-motivated with a passion for continuous learning and professional growth.
  • Willingness to travel and visit customers across Australia.

If you're ready to take the next step & make a true impact, Apply Now



  • Macquarie Park, New South Wales, Australia Wolters Kluwer Full time $90,000 - $120,000 per year

    Job SummaryThe Customer Success Associate (CSA) is responsible for building and maintaining post sales strategic relationships with Enablon assigned accounts. This role will serve as a trusted advisor to accounts in complex industries, providing strategic vision, technical insights, and domain knowledge to ensure customer success and system adoption. It will...


  • Macquarie Park, New South Wales, Australia RedeemX Pty Ltd Full time $60,000 - $100,000 per year

    Customer Success ExecutiveRedeemX Pty LtdMacquarie Park, Sydney NSWFull time- 1 position.ABOUT USRedeemX is Australia's leading supplier and developer of  a Customer Experience Management (CXM) platform for the hospitality industry. For over 13 years we have been at the forefront of developing a CXM platform that is powerful, affordable and scalable. Our...


  • Macquarie Park, New South Wales, Australia ShiftCare Full time $80,000 - $120,000 per year

    At ShiftCare, our Customer Success team is dedicated to helping our customers get the most value from our platform. We're looking for a Customer Success Account Manager who is both technically minded and customer-focused, with a passion for solving complex problems and driving success for our larger customers.This role sits at the intersection of Customer...


  • Macquarie Park, Australia ShiftCare Full time $80,000 - $120,000 per year

    At ShiftCare, our Customer Success Managers play a pivotal role in optimising workflows, analysing customer trends, and driving continuous improvement in the customer experience.We're looking for a Senior Customer Success Manager with a strong focus on onboarding and project management, particularly experienced in working with larger accounts. You'll be...


  • Tamarama, New South Wales, Australia Earlybeurt Full time

    Company DescriptionEarlybeurt is a company that leverages AI technology to improve sales, marketing, and service processes. We deploy AI agents to nurture and qualify leads, automate repetitive marketing tasks, and manage customer service inquiries 24/7. Our approach is client-focused, building tailored AI solutions that adapt to unique processes, ensuring...


  • Waterloo, New South Wales, Australia Eco Concepts Australia Pty Ltd (Eco Outdoor) Full time $80,000 - $120,000 per year

    Customer Support & Fulfilment ManagerSydney - Full TimeWe are looking for…Hopefully, you We're seeking an experienced, people-focused Customer Success Manager to lead our Fulfilment & Customer Support team in Waterloo, NSW.This is an exciting opportunity for someone who thrives in a fast-paced operational environment, balancing hands-on fulfilment...


  • Sydney, New South Wales , Australia Ben Rasa's Demo Org Full time $90,000 - $120,000 per year

    Summary:We are seeking a highly motivated and experienced Customer Success Manager to join our team. The successful candidate will be responsible for ensuring our customers are satisfied with our products and services, and will work closely with our sales and support teams to ensure customer retention and growth.Responsibilities:Build and maintain strong...


  • Botany, New South Wales , Australia Tcr Gse Full time $80,000 - $120,000 per year

    We're Hiring – Customer Success Manager (Sydney)Join TCR Group, the global leader in GSE solutions, operating across 200 airports, 300+ airlines, 30 countries & 5 continents.We're looking for someone who speaks the aviation language, is resourceful, highly organised, and passionate about customer success. You'll manage key accounts, build strong...


  • Beresfield, New South Wales , Australia SafeGauge Pty Full time $80,000 - $120,000 per year

    The Customer Success Manager will support new and existing key customer accounts to ensure that SafeGauge's products are effectively introduced, implemented, supported within those accounts. They will function as the primary contact point for these customers to resolve issues and enhance their experience, engaging internal staff as required to support.Why...


  • Sydney, New South Wales , Australia Employment Hero Full time $80,000 - $120,000 per year

    Who we areEmployment Hero is on a mission to make employment easier and more valuable for everyone. Our Employment Operating System brings hiring, HR, payroll and benefits into an all-in-one solution.Since our inception in 2014, we've scaled to a $2 billion valuation and gained a presence in 6 countries globally – Australia, New Zealand, Singapore,...